In our 24th issue, we feature two special sections. The first, \"Soundscapes of Poetry,\" edited by Katherine Whatley, is, as she puts it, \"filled with the sounds of living,\" featuring a wide array of sonic poetry that ranges from rhythmic pieces to soundscapes and onomatopoeia. For our second special section, \"A Bug's Poem,\" Hevin Karakurt put out a call that reached toward our roots, bringing a menagerie crawling to the surface: Hymenoptera, Coleoptera, Arachnida, and Mantodea. The buzzing, scuttering undertones of these works echo through the pages, creating a new poetic soundscape that loops right back to the start. In addition, our yearly general sections feature new poetry and poetry in translation from many different countries and languages. This year's edition also showcases the artwork of contributor Pranav Prakash, a scholar of religion, literature, and book arts in South Asian and Persian societies. Pranav's inkwork evokes beauty, history, knowledge, and devastation all at once, serving as a powerful reminder of what surrounds art and language, and the strength we find within them as we fight for justice and peace.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"STANFORD UNIVERSITY PRESS","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":48013618282548,"sku":"9798985966541","price":31.99,"currency_code":"AUD","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/woodslane.com.au\/products\/9798985966541","provider":"Woodslane","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
